A two-way table answers two questions at once — year group and travel, gender and sport. This lesson teaches cell-reading with both labels and the subtract-then-cross-check routine for missing numbers.
| Walk | Don't walk | Total | |
| Year 5 | 14 | ? | 30 |
| Year 6 | 18 | 10 | 28 |
| Total | 32 | 26 | 58 |
The cell where the Year 5 row meets the Walk column: 14 Year 5 walkers.
Year 5 total is 30, walkers 14 → non-walkers 30 − 14 = 16.
Column check: 16 + 10 = 26 ✓ — rows and columns must both work.

A table that sorts the same data by two questions at once — for example year group (rows) against how children travel (columns), with totals for each.
Subtract the known cells in its row from the row total (or use its column) — then check the answer works in the other direction too.
